首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建私有镜像

创建私有镜像是指在云计算环境中,将一个已有的虚拟机或服务器的操作系统和应用程序配置保存为一个私有的镜像文件,以便在需要时快速部署相同的虚拟机或服务器。私有镜像可以包含操作系统、应用程序、配置文件和其他软件,可以大大提高部署速度和一致性。

私有镜像的优势在于可以快速部署相同的虚拟机或服务器,节省时间和成本。同时,私有镜像可以保护应用程序和数据的安全性,避免被他人窃取或篡改。

私有镜像的应用场景包括:

  • 快速部署相同的虚拟机或服务器
  • 保护应用程序和数据的安全性
  • 避免重复配置和安装软件

推荐的腾讯云相关产品和产品介绍链接地址:

腾讯云镜像可以帮助用户快速创建和管理私有镜像,并支持多种操作系统和应用程序的部署。腾讯云虚拟机则可以帮助用户快速部署和管理虚拟机,并支持多种操作系统和应用程序的部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Docker 镜像创建与构建私有

一、Docker镜像创建方法 docker镜像是除了docker的核心技术之外,也是应用发布的标准格式。...创建镜像的方法有三种,分别是基于已有镜像创建、基于本地模板创建及基于dockerfile创建。...1、基于已有镜像创建 基于已有镜像创建主要使用 docker commit 命令,其实质就是把一个容器里面运行的程序及该程序的运行环境打包起来生成新的镜像。...二、搭建私有库及其使用方法 随着创建镜像增多,就需要有一个保存镜像的地方,这就是仓库,目前有两种仓库:公共仓库和私有仓库,公司的生产环境中大多数都是保存到私有仓库的,最简单的还是在公共仓库上下载镜像,...以及如何查看上传的镜像呢?(上传至私有仓库的镜像是无法使用普通的ls命令查看的)。

71910

netcore 创建腾讯云私有镜像 发布到docker 实战

这是一种笨方法,理想的方法是,在本地编译成镜像,然后推送到镜像仓库,服务器的docker pull  这个镜像就可以了。...镜像仓库有Docker Hub,官网:https://hub.docker.com/,网上很多实例 我今天要用腾讯云的镜像仓库,进入腾讯云容器服务,下的镜像仓库,二话不说先建一个镜像: 看这个指引,...生成镜像时间有点长,成功之后,看一下本机是不是有了这个镜像: docker images  登陆腾讯云的镜像仓库: docker login --username=登录名 ccr.ccs.tencentyun.com...,会发现有了一个镜像 好了,进入腾讯云命令行,从腾讯云镜像仓库中获取 这个镜像: 一样的,先要登陆 docker login --username=登陆 ccr.ccs.tencentyun.com...pull 镜像: docker pull ccr.ccs.tencentyun.com/pyoa/pyoa01 成功后查看,docker images:  拉取成功了,最后,生成 一个这个镜像的容器

2.9K20

docker上传镜像私有仓库_docker仓库的创建

目录 一、私有仓库的搭建与配置 二、镜像上传至私有仓库 ---- 一、私有仓库的搭建与配置 所谓的 Docker 私有仓库,就是指企业内部所使用的仓库。...仓库用于存放各种镜像,区别在于公有仓库所存储的都是一些通用型的镜像比如N Tomcat 镜像、ginx 镜像等。私有仓库则用于存放自身开发的企业级应用。...如果想要在一个局域网来共享一些镜像,那么就需要用到私有仓库。 1....创建私有仓库,占用 5000 端口; [root@192 ~]# docker run -di --name=registry -p 5000:5000 registry 此时已经算是完成了私有仓库的构建...测试连接,再次在本地浏览器中输入 192.168.200.129:5000/v2/_catalog 进行访问,可以看到相较于刚创建私有仓库列表中已添加了 jdk1.8; jdk1.8 上传至私有仓库成功

2.2K20

Docker镜像私有仓库

所以为了更好的管理镜像,Docker 不仅提供了一个中央仓库,同时也允许我们搭建本地私有仓库。...容器镜像 创建 registry 仓库容器 测试容器应用 搭建过程 a、拉取registry容器镜像 docker pull registry b、创建registry仓库容器 1、创建持久化存储...,将容器镜像存储目录/var/lib/registry挂载到本地/opt/myregistry下: mkdir /opt/myregistry 2、创建 registry 容器: docker run...1.2、registry仓库应用-上传镜像 上传镜像步骤 设置docker仓库为registry本地仓库 给需要存储的镜像打tag 上传镜像到registry仓库 演示案例 将baishuming2020...创建认证信息 创建带认证的registry容器 指定仓库地址 登录认证 实现过程 a、安装需要认证的包 yum -y install httpd-tools b、创建存放认证信息的文件 mkdir

3.1K10

Docker 构建私有镜像仓库

在使用Docker一段时间后,往往会发现手头积累了大量的自定义镜像文件,这些文件通过公有仓库进行管理并不方便,另外有时候只是希望在内部用户之间进行分享,不希望暴露出去.这种情况下,就有必要搭建一个本地私有镜像仓库...,本小结将具体介绍两个私有仓库的搭建,其中包括Registry,以及Vmware的Harbor企业仓库...,新版本的Registry基于Golang进行了重构,提供更好的性能和扩展性,并且支持Docker 1.6+的API,非常适合用来构建私有镜像注册服务器.官方仓库中也提供了Registry的镜像,因此用户可以通过容器运行和源码安装两种方...,则我们的docker私有仓库搭建成功....upgrade [root@localhost harbor]# vim harbor.cfg hostname=192.168.1.5 #本机IP地址 ui_url_protocol=https 3.创建目录并到制定目录生成加密

1.4K20

Harbor私有镜像仓库搭建

2.角色访问控制可以创建用户和设置角色控制镜像的访问权限,例如只读或读写权限。3.镜像复制支持在多个Harbor实例之间复制镜像,保证分布式部署可以访问相同镜像。...综上,Harbor提供全面的镜像管理功能,有助于构建私有Docker镜像仓库服务。...------#Docker-compose常用命令docker-compose up -d ###后台启动,如果容器不存在根据镜像自动创建docker-compose down...-v ###停止容器并删除容器docker-compose start ###启动容器,容器不存在就无法启动,不会自动创建镜像docker-compose.../install.sh---harbor项目开机自启使用 docker-compose 创建的 Harbor 这样的项目,可以通过在系统中配置 systemd unit 来实现开机自启动。

57730

Dockerfile 构建私有镜像

使用 Dockerfile 定制镜像 ---- 镜像的定制实际上就是定制每一层所添加的配置、文件。我们可以把每一层修改、安装、构建、操作的命令都写入一个脚本,这个脚本就是 Dockerfile。...创建 Dockerfile 文件 2. 构建镜像 2. Dockerfile 指令详解 ---- COPY 复制文件 ADD 更高级的复制文件 ADD 指令和 COPY 的格式和性质基本一致。...在 Dockerfile 中写入这样的声明有两个好处: 是帮助镜像使用者理解这个镜像服务的守护端口,以方便配置映射。...只有当以当前镜像为基础镜像,去构建下一级镜像的时候才会被执行。 Dockerfile 中的其他指令都是为了定制当前镜像而逐步内的,唯有 ONBUILD 是为了帮助别人定制自己而准备的。 3....其他镜像制作方式 ---- docker save 和 docker load

80320

docker私有镜像仓库部署使用

nexus 不光可以做为私人的maven仓库,还可以作为docker的镜像仓库 如何使用nexus 做maven仓库,可以参考: 部署maven私服 下面将介绍nexus作为docker镜像仓库的使用...-privileged=true -v /d/mongo/nexus-data:/nexus-data sonatype/nexus3 8081端口用于访问nexus 8082端口用于docker访问私有镜像厂库...- 8081:8081 - 8082:8082 valumes: - nexus-data:/nexus-data nexus创建...docker镜像仓库 类型 功能 hosted 私有仓库(替代harbor) proxy 访问不能直接到达的网络,如另一个私有仓库,或者国外的公共仓库 group 聚合类型的仓库。...它可以将前面我们创建的3个仓库聚合成一个URL对外提供服务,可以屏蔽后端的差异性,实现类似透明代理的功能 参考:https://segmentfault.com/a/1190000015629878

97720

搭建Docker私有镜像仓库

1、镜像仓库服务器 假设IP 为 192.168.0.100 下载镜像registry docker pull registry # 或者加载离线镜像包 docker load -i registry.tar.gz...映射端口;访问宿主机的5000端口就访问到registry容器的服务了; # --restart=always:这是重启的策略,假如这个容器异常退出会自动重启容器; # --name registry:创建容器命名为...data/registry:/var/lib/registry -p 5000:5000 --restart=always --name registry registry:latest 2、其他需要使用私有镜像仓库的服务器...# 也可以通过Dockerfile自行构建 docker tag busybox:latest 192.168.0.100:5000/openjdk:8 # 上传私有镜像仓库 docker push...192.168.0.100:5000/openjdk:8 拉取镜像示例: # 拉取私有镜像仓库的镜像 docker pull 192.168.0.100:5000/openjdk:8 by Sven

1K10

docker 创建镜像

假设我们现在需要搭建DB集群,传统的做法是这样的:在虚拟机创建多个centos并且全部安装DB,操作过程很麻烦;但是现在我们基于docker已经运行了一个容器,并且容器中已经安装了DB,完全可以当前容器的内容封装为一个新镜像...,然后再去执行多次这个镜像即可拥有多个DB环境.目前我已经有一个容器ID:b9e53b08485a,容器运行centos,并且已经安装DB,首先将容器提交镜像,产生为一个独立的镜像(1).执行命令:docker... commit -m="centos installed db" -a="gao" b9e53b08485a centosbygao:7  //将容器创建为新的镜像参数说明:-m:提交的描述信息 -a:...指定镜像作者 b9e53b08485a是容器ID  centosbygao:7:指定要创建的目标镜像名(2).查看生产的镜像: docker  images  输出内容:REPOSITORY         ...       565MBcentos              7                   9f38484d220f        5 weeks ago         202MB(3).运行镜像生成多个容器

10600

docker创建私有仓库

由于网速和大中华局域网效果,使得我们在DockerHub下载镜像的速度很慢,甚至一些国内的镜像仓库,也感觉速度不是很好。...#export TMPDIR="/mnt/bigdrive/docker-tmp" DOCKER_OPTS="--insecure-registry dl.dockerpool.com:5000" 创建私有仓库...本文记录以Docker官方提供的镜像Registry 创建本地私有仓库,创建方式和启动一个普通镜像的方式是一样。...1.在私有仓库服务器快速创建镜像仓库,运行如下代码: docker run -p 5000:5000 registry:2.0 运行上述命令后,会从DockerHub上拉取registry镜像并在本地启动...可以看到registry的镜像和一个本地ubuntu:12.04的镜像 3.重新标记一个本地镜像私有仓库的版本,这里将本地的ubuntu 12.04标记为localhost:5000/ubuntu:1204

1.8K90
领券